OZONE PLAYER
Insane Logic
The 'ozone player' is Finn Otso Pakarinen who presents a cleverly constructed mix of synthesized sounds and samples influenced by 'The Night's Dawn' trilogy by Peter F. Hamilton.
This unpredictable and inventive CD explores unusual musical avenues. It is demanding on the listener but don't be discouraged- this is not soulless electronic music! The melody on "Shipping", for example, is both beautiful and memorable.
Indeed there is much to admire on 'Insane Logic' - the stunning stereo effects on 'Warezz', the haunting 'musique concréte' of the title track and the programmed percussion and voices on 'Casino Mobile'.
It is interesting to trace on Otso's web site the artist's early musical history - from a taste for Black Sabbath, Deep Purple and Uriah Heep through the prog giants then Kraftwerk and Tangerine Dream to XTC etc - all good character builders for sure!
He is now described as an 'electro composer' and this genesis has taken some time- 7 years to be precise to complete this project.
Was the journey worth it? Well, Otso's ideas are great but are perhaps not fully realised- yet. (What, another 7 years?!-ed.)
I look forward to hearing more of Otso's works and hope this release is not consigned to the archives of soundtrack history as it deserves a much better fate. Check it out!
